A cylinder has a radius of 4 inches. If the volume of the cylinder is 144 pie^3, what is the height of the cylinder in terms of pie

Final answer:

To find the height of the cylinder with a given volume of 144π cubic inches and a radius of 4 inches, we use the formula V = πr²h and solve for h, resulting in a height of 9 inches.

Step-by-step explanation:

The question asks about determining the height of a cylinder when given the volume and the radius. To find the height (h) of the cylinder, we use the formula for the volume of a cylinder: V = πr²h, where V is the volume, r is the radius, and h is the height. The volume of the cylinder is given as 144π cubic inches and the radius is given as 4 inches.

First, substitute the known values into the formula:

  • V = π × (4 inches)² × h
  • 144π = π × 16 × h

Next, solve for h:

  • h = 144π / (16π)
  • h = 144 / 16
  • h = 9 inches

Therefore, the height of the cylinder is 9 inches.
